John received a z score of 0.5 on an exam. Peter received a T score of 60 on that same exam. What can be said about their relative performance on the exam?
a. There is not enough information to compare John's and Peter's exam scores.
b. Peter received a higher raw score than John on the exam.
c. John received a higher raw score than Peter on the exam.
d. The two test-takers actually received the same score on the exam.
The answer is (a) There is not enough information to compare John's and Peter's exam scores.
A z score and a T score are both measures of how a particular score compares to the mean in a distribution, but they are calculated using different formulas. A z score measures the number of standard deviations a score is from the mean, while a T score is a linear transformation of the raw score that is adjusted to have a mean of 50 and a standard deviation of 10.
Without additional information about the specific distribution of scores, the mean, and the standard deviation, we cannot determine the raw scores of John and Peter or compare their relative performance on the exam. The z score of 0.5 for John indicates that his score is half a standard deviation above the mean, but we don't know the actual raw score. Similarly, the T score of 60 for Peter indicates that his score is above the mean, but we don't have enough information to determine the raw score or make a direct comparison between the two.

I have no idea how to solve this problem, could someone help me?△ABC∼△XYZ. Find the values of x and b (side lengths).
The symbol ∼ denotes similarity, that is, the triangles ABC and XYZ are similar. When two triangles are similar, they have the same shape but not necessarily the same size and their corresponding angles are the same. In turn, the corresponding sides of two corresponding triangles are in the same ratio. Graphically,
\(\frac{a}{a^{\prime}}=\frac{b}{b^{\prime}}=\frac{c}{c^{\prime}}\)So to find x in the small triangle, you have
\(\begin{gathered} \frac{15}{10}=\frac{9}{x} \\ \text{ Multiply by x on both sides of the equation} \\ \frac{15}{10}\cdot x=\frac{9}{x}\cdot x \\ \frac{15}{10}x=9 \\ \text{ Multiply by }\frac{10}{15}\text{ on both sides of the equation} \\ \frac{10}{15}\cdot\frac{15}{10}x=9\cdot\frac{10}{15} \\ x=6 \end{gathered}\)Finally, to find b in the large triangle, you have
\(\begin{gathered} \frac{15}{10}=\frac{b}{8} \\ \text{ Multiply by 8 on both sides of the equation} \\ \frac{15}{10}\cdot8=\frac{b}{8}\cdot8 \\ 12=b \end{gathered}\)Therefore, the lengths of the sides x and b are

An object occupies the region between the unit sphere at the origin and a sphere of radius 2 with center at the origin, and has density equal to the distance from the origin. Find the mass.
The mass of the solid is 7π/2 units.
The task is to calculate the mass of the solid.
Step-by-step solution: The solid occupies the region between the unit sphere at the origin and a sphere of radius 2 with the center at the origin. The spherical coordinates in 3D space are (r,θ,φ), where:r = radius, θ = polar angle, φ = azimuthal angle.
The equations of the given sphere are r=1 for the unit sphere and r=2 for the second sphere.
Using spherical coordinates, the solid can be defined as 1≤r≤2, 0≤θ≤2π, 0≤φ≤π.
The density is equal to the distance from the origin, i.e. ρ = r.
The mass of the solid is given by the triple integral ρ dV taken over the solid, where dV is the volume element in spherical coordinates.dV = r²sin φ dφdθdr
The limits for the triple integral are: 0 ≤ θ ≤ 2π, 0 ≤ φ ≤ π, and 1 ≤ r ≤ 2.M = ∭ρ dV = ∭r(r²sin φ) dφdθdr= ∫[0,2π]∫[0,π]∫[1,2] r³sin φ drdφdθ= ∫[0,2π]∫[0,π] -cos φ [r⁴/4]₁ ₂ drdφdθ= ∫[0,2π]∫[0,π] 7/4 cos φ dφdθ= ∫[0,2π] 7sin φ/4 ]₀ π dθ= 14π/4= 7π/2 units.
The mass of the solid is 7π/2 units.
